Math Skills Required to Unlock Clues

There are five clues to crack to solve the mystery:

  • Clue 1: What is the value of the underlined digit? (5-7 Digit Numbers)
  • Clue 2: Multiply numbers ending in zeroes (2-4 Digit Numbers)
  • Clue 3: Converting Mixed Number Fractions to Improper Fractions
  • Clue 4: Solve Equations (with positive integers only)
  • Clue 5: Solving with Parenthesis (mixture of add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division used throughout).

Students must use critical thinking skills to determine which of the possible hideouts to eliminate based on the clue.

How long will this activity take?

The time to complete will vary anywhere between 30 minutes and 2 hours! It mainly depends on how familiar your students are with the math mystery format and how difficult they find math skills covered in the particular mystery. Please check the math skills outlined in the clues above to help determine suitability for your class. I recommend pacing this activity by giving students one clue at a time. Once the whole class has completed a clue, move on to the next clue within the same lesson or the next math session. New math content presented? Make a lesson out of it by modeling the math before diving into the clue. I like to say, "We must learn something new before attempting the next clue." Recognize that in a multi-digit number, a digit in one place represents 10 times as much as it represents in the place to its right and 1/10 of what it represents in the place to its left.
Explain patterns in the number of zeros of the product when multiplying a number by powers of 10, and explain patterns in the placement of the decimal point when a decimal is multiplied or divided by a power of 10. Use whole-number exponents to denote powers of 10.
Use parentheses, brackets, or braces in numerical expressions, and evaluate expressions with these symbols.
